FINANCIAL SUPPORT

A death in the family can cause huge financial problems for those left behind: even for those who have set aside funds. The pressures of trying to pay for unexpected funeral costs is the most quoted causes of depression or helplessness for many people who are bereaved.

As your appointed funeral director, our priority is to ensure you stay within your financial means whilst placing the wishes of your deceased loved one foremost.

We work with Down to Earth, the Quaker Social Action Financial Support group.  If you are worried about the cost of a funeral you can access their helpful resources HERE, or refer yourself, a family member, or a friend to their service using these contact details:

Public Health Funerals

An outline of the statutory duty of local councils to cremate or bury people who have died alone, in poverty, or are unclaimed by their relatives. This fund can only be accessed by members of a local council.

DEATH CAFE

Working as a key partner with Redbridge Libraries and as part of the Dying Matters festival, we are proud to host regular Death Cafés at the various library locations.

Whether you’ve experienced the loss of a loved one, want to share your perceptions on the concept of finite endings, or want to celebrate life and living, come and join us for inspiring, supportive, and life-affirming discussions in a relaxed setting and over tea and cake.

WORKSHOPS

We offer a range of tailor-made workshops designed to enhance understanding of the needs of different communities in relation to religious rites and basic burial etiquette.

As well as a Funeral Awareness Training programme specifically designed for staff working in care homes and care agencies, we also deliver workshops on Funeral Planning and honouring wishes; including information on different religious funeral rites such as Buddhist, Christian, Hindu, and Muslim funerals.

TRAINING FOR CARE HOME STAFF

With around 100,000 people dying in care homes annually (Office of National Statistics), dealing with end-of-life care and death is inevitably part of the job of being a care worker. 

As well as a Funeral Awareness Training programme specifically designed for staff working in care homes and care agencies, we also deliver workshops on Funeral Planning and honouring wishes; including information on different religious funeral rites such as Buddhist, Christian, Hindu, and Muslim funerals.

Multi-Faith Funerals

We are sensitive and committed to meeting the cultural needs of the many wonderful and diverse communities which make up Great Britain.

Our years of experience and service to these communities ensures the funeral rites and rituals you need are honoured, respected and delivered.

Our funeral home offers specialist washing and dressing facilities that enable communities to come together and care for their loved ones in a beautiful and comfortable environment.
